Abstract

One of the very complex HR problems is the provision of motivation according to the needs of each employee so that ultimately employees feel satisfied in working in a company, both material and non-material motivation and job satisfaction. This study aims to determine the effect of motivation and job satisfaction on Islamic organizational citizenship behavior (OCB). This research is quantitative research based on explanatory research using sampling the saturated sample method by distributing questionnaires to the furniture industry employees of Budi Jaya Jepara. The analysis method uses Partial Least Square (PLS) with the help of WARP-PLS 0.3 software. The results of this study indicate that motivation affects job satisfaction. Job satisfaction affects Islamic organizational citizenship behavior (OCB) and motivation does not directly affect Islamic organizational citizenship behavior (OCB) because of differences in the salary system and marital status.
